Hiraishi Station was a railway station in the city of Yokote, Akita Prefecture, Japan, operated by JR East. The station closed on 12 March 2022.

The Sanctuary of Our Lady of Nazaré is a Marian shrine that memorializes an ancient miracle that occurred under the intercession of the Virgin Mary. It is located on the hilltop called O Sítio, overlooking Nazaré, in Portugal, and was founded in the 14th century.
